Effects of different polymers on mechanical properties of bituminous binders and hot mixtures
چکیده انگلیسی

In this study, rheological and mechanical properties of bituminous binders and hot mixtures modified by different polymeric additives, Kraton D1101, Kraton MD243 and Evatane®2805, were examined. In all samples, the amount of the polymeric additive was kept constant at 4 wt.% of the bituminous binder. The experiments showed that with the addition of the polymer to binder, Marshall stability, retained Marshall stability, indirect tensile strength, tensile strength ratio, stiffness and fatigue life values of the bituminous hot mixtures increased. The effect of the EVA on stiffness modulus and fatigue life was found to be notable. When toughness index values were compared, it was detected that mixtures with SBS- Kraton MD243 demonstrated the highest elasticity, while those with EVA-Evatane®2805 showed the least. The rheological experiments on the binders figured out that by the use of MD243, a new type of styrene–butadiene–styrene additive, low viscosity values could be obtained. This implies that if MD243 is utilized to bituminous mixtures, an effect on bituminous mixtures similar to that created by D1101 addition could be obtained by consuming less amount of energy.


► Two types of SBS and a type of EVA were used for bitumen modification.
► 4 wt.% Modifier was used to obtain PG 70-22.
► All polymers increased the Marshall stability and stiffness of mixtures.
► Resistance to moisture damage and fatigue cracks were increased with polymer usage.
